titleOfInvention Process for producing D-γ-methylleucine
abstract (57) [Summary] [Structure] 5- (2,2-dimethylpropyl) hydantoin is treated with an microbial cell having a capability of asymmetrically cleaving and hydrolyzing a hydantoin ring or a treated product of the microbial cell in an aqueous medium. To produce D-γ-methylleucine. As the microorganism, Agrobacterium ( A grobacterium , Pseudomonas sp. ( Ps eudomonas), Bacillus (Bacillu s), Alcaligenes (Alcaligenes), Arthrobacter genus ( Arthrobacter ), Aureobacterium genus ( Aureobacterium) m ), microorganisms belonging to the genus Rhodococcus ( Rhodococcus ), and the like. [Effect] According to the method of the present invention, not only non-natural D-γ-methylleucine, which was not obtained by the conventional fermentation method, can be obtained, but also D-γ-methylleucine can be biochemically efficiently obtained. It can be manufactured.
